TICKET-4471 — Signature check failing on nightly cron (Murkwell scheduler)

Nightly job drifted 14 minutes, then its artifact failed signature verification. Root cause: the runner cached a rotated key. New folks: never trust cached keys after a rotation notice. Clear the runner cache, re-fetch, and re-run. Verification should be done against the current deploy key, which is as follows.

release key, fahaf-bajof: bky3_Xam

Migration Guide — Step 4: Swap in the new address autocomplete widget. Alright, this is the fun part. Rip out the old Plottly widget include and drop in the new Wayfinder component wherever addresses get typed. The API surface is nearly identical, so most call sites just need the namespace change. One gotcha: Wayfinder won't boot without its runtime settings present at page load. Paste the following into your environment config before testing locally.

config for tajof-tajef:
ralael:
  pin: 3468
  metrics_host: metrics.ralael.lumicsys.internal
  tenant: casath
  seal: seal_c325d9c6

Finance Review Summary — Northvale Region

Northvale closed the quarter at 94% of plan. Renewals held steady; new business lagged due to the delayed Tarnbrook launch. Expenses came in 3% under budget, largely from slower hiring. The pipeline for next quarter looks adequate but concentrated in two accounts. Recommend tightening discount approvals above 10%. Forward-looking considerations are captured in the note below.

internal memo for kawip-hadug: Headcount on the Wenwyn team goes from 7 to 140 by the end of January. Gross margin on Wenwyn came in at 20 percent against a plan of 15 percent.